Dublin, Jan. 28, 2016 -- Research and Markets has announced the addition of the "Global Wearable Technology Market Analysis & Trends - Industry Forecast to 2020" report to their offering.
The Global Wearable Technology Market is poised to grow at a CAGR of around 18.2% in the next 5 years to reach approximately $33.4 billion by 2020.
This industry report analyzes the global markets for Wearable Technology across all the given segments in the research scope. It presents historical market data for 2012, 2013, 2014 revenue estimations are presented for 2015 and forecasts till 2020. The study focuses on market trends, leading players, supply chain trends, technological innovations, key developments, and future strategies. The report provides comprehensive market analysis across four major geographies such as North America, Europe, Asia Pacific and Other parts of the world.
The study presents detailed market analysis with inputs derived from industry professionals. A special focus has been made on 17 countries such as U.S., Canada, U.K., Germany, Spain, France, Italy, China, Brazil, Saudi Arabia, South Africa, etc. The market data is gathered from extensive primary research and secondary research. The market size is calculated based on the revenue generated through sales from all the given segments and sub segments in the research scope. The market sizing analysis includes both top-down and bottom-up approaches for data validation and accuracy measures.
